COPELAND residents have until Sunday to have their say on significant changes to the Local Plan that are being considered.
The Local Plan will guide development and investment in the borough until 2038.
Local Plans are used to help decide on planning applications and other planning related decisions.
A spokesperson at Copeland Borough Council said: "The changes under consideration include elements such as additional and deleted site allocations for housing and employment development, amendments to settlement boundaries and new policies."
